The study may last up to approximately 64 days for each participant.', 'detailedDescription': 'This is a Phase 1, open-label, fixed-sequence, 2-period clinical study in healthy participants. Approximately 36 participants will be enrolled in the study to achieve 25 evaluable participants.\n\nHealthy male and/or female participants, aged 18 to 65 years (inclusive), not of Asian descent, with body mass index (BMI) between 18 and 32 kg/m², and who are medically healthy with no clinically significant abnormalities.\n\nThe study consists of screening (28 days), 2 study periods, and a 7-day follow-up.\n\nMirdametinib will be given as a single 6-mg dose on 2 separate occasions: once on Day 1 and once on Day 22. Carbamazepine ER will be given twice daily for 21 days beginning on Day 8.\n\nOn Day 1 of Period 1, participants will receive a 6-mg single oral dose of mirdametinib followed by PK sampling for 168 hours (Day 8). In Period 2, participants will receive carbamazepine extended-release (ER) twice daily for 21 days with a titration schedule (100 mg twice daily \\[BID\\] for 2 days, 200 mg BID for 2 days, and 300 mg BID for the remaining days). On Day 22, participants will receive a 6-mg single dose of mirdametinib with the morning dose of carbamazepine ER, followed by PK sampling for 168 hours.'}, 'eligibilityModule': {'sex': 'ALL', 'stdAges': ['ADULT', 'OLDER_ADULT'], 'maximumAge': '65 Years', 'minimumAge': '18 Years', 'healthyVolunteers': True, 'eligibilityCriteria': 'Inclusion Criteria:\n\n1.
